Quick Summary
The Blackberry Curve 8900 sports the familiar bar style with full QWERTY keyboard and trackball navigation making the 8900 one of the most user friendly designs to date. Key features include a 3.2 megapixel camera with auto focus, microSD slot good for up to 16GB, GPS, WiFi, adjustable text size, WAP 2.0 browser and stereo Bluetooth perfect for playing back videos or your entire music collection.
- Data: Edge, GPRS
- Design: Bar
- Keyboard/Buttons: Full QWERTY
- Type: Smartphone
- Talk Time: 5.5 hours (330 minutes)
- Touch Screen:
- Camera Features: Video capture, auto focus, 2x digital zoom, image stablization
- Bluetooth: Yes, v2.0 Supported Profiles: HSP, HFP 1.5, DUN, SAP, PBA, A2DP, AVRC
- Operating System: Blackberry OS
- Wi-Fi: Yes

"Amazing BB"
The good: Compact size, yet still comfortable qwerty keyboard. Breathtaking display- better than all previous models. Excellent battery life (3-4 days). All the options and reliability expected with the BB name. The push email is flawless, and the 3.2 mp camera takes excellent photos! The bad: No touch screen (but this could also be a plus).
